Prof. Stefan Aufenanger
Profile
Stefan Aufenanger is professor of Pedagogy and Media Education at the University of Mainz, Germany.At the University of Mainz Dr Aufenanger is coordinator of several projects, eg. ’Children and brands’, ‘Media competence and Gender’, and his workgroup is developing multimedia programs for primary schools and for higher education. Dr Aufenanger was a member of the board of the Association for Media Education and Communication Culture (GMK) (Bielefeld), and speaker of the division Media Education of the German Association of Educational Science (DGfE). Dr Aufenanger is co-editor of Computer + Unterricht and member of the advisory board of medien + erziehung (media + education), as well as consultant on several research projects. He is a teacher in further education programmes for kindergarden, elementary and primary school teachers. His main research topics are: electronic media and the family, television and children, children and advertising, multimedia in education, moral education, qualitative research methods.
